Why You Should All Become Computer Engineers ECE 200 (Fall 2015) Saurabh Bagchi School of Electrical and Computer Engineering Purdue University.

Slides:



Advertisements
Similar presentations
Computing Studies Is it for me? Click here to find out…
Advertisements

Lesson 1: Introduction to IT Business and Careers
Department of Mathematics and Computer Science
Computer Science and Information Technology Concentrations Minors Career Opportunities.
Presenters: Adam Andy Andy Rachel
Digital Systems Emphasis for Electrical Engineering Students Digital Systems skills are very valuable for electrical engineers Digital systems are the.
Department of Electronic Engineering City University of Hong Kong BEng (Hons) in Information Engineering 資訊工程學榮譽工學士 BEng (Hons) in Information Engineering.
September Carl Hauser Associate Professor October 2007 Computer Science Programs School of Electrical Engineering and Computer Science.
ENGIN Introduction to Computer Engineering.
T H E U N I V E R S I T Y O F B R I T I S H C O L U M B I A UBChttp:// 1 The Department of Electrical and Computer Engineering.
Addressing software engineering issues in student software projects across different curricula Dušanka Bošković Computing and Informatics Bachelor Programme.
© 2003 Turoff 1 The Nature of Information Systems and Employment in IS Murray Turoff Information Systems Department.
The Challenging (and Fun!) World of Computer Engineering Professor Dave Meyer School of Electrical & Computer Engineering Purdue University.
CS 1 with Robots CS1301 – Where it Fits Institute for Personal Robots in Education (IPRE)‏
California State University East Bay
A brief look at Canadian post secondary computer technology studies.
1 Hochschule Esslingen Business Administration International Industrial Management(B.Sc.) Industrial Management/Automotive Industry (B.Sc.) Innovation.
David L. Spooner1 IT Education: An Interdisciplinary Approach David L. Spooner Rensselaer Polytechnic Institute.
“Electrical Engineering focuses on the fundamental aspects of the discipline such as network analysis, electronics, electronic system design, signal processing,
Computers Are Your Future Eleventh Edition Chapter 10: Careers & Certification Copyright © 2011 Pearson Education, Inc. Publishing as Prentice Hall1.
Software Developer Career. ◦ Desktop Program development ◦ Web Program Development ◦ Mobile Program Development.
IT CAREERS Prepared by: Careene McCallum-Rodney. Computer Technician  Computer technicians:  install,  repair,  maintain,  and analyze many different.
Welcome to USA DAY at University of South Alabama School of Computer and Information Sciences
/ 1 World-Class HR at GE Why GE? WHY EEDP?
MASTER’S PROGRAM ELECTRICAL AND COMPUTER ENGINEERING Dr. Doug Lyon, and Dr. Jerry Sergent Program Co-Directors/ Chairs of CpE and EE Depts.
T.L. Kennedy Secondary School
© UNT in partnership with TEA1 7 th Grade Career Exploration Module Career Focus: Electrical Engineer Occupation.
School of Management & Information Systems
OverviewOverview – Preparation – Day in the Life – Earnings – Employment – Career Path Forecast – ResourcesPreparationDay in the LifeEarningsEmploymentCareer.
Web Design. Course Description This course is designed to Provide the necessary skills and training –for an entry level position in the field of Web.
ABET’s coming to Rose! Your involvement Monday, Nov 5, 2012.
You be the Judge! BPA Texas Teachers Provide Academics.
The Department of Electrical and Computer Engineering BS Degrees in: Electrical Enginnering (EE) -Medical Preparation Option Computer Engineering (CompE)
Counseling for IIT/NIT Aspirants Presented by YES Centre and The Hindu Group 16 June 2013, Hyderabad.
Eastern Mediterranean University
Cool Computing News Computing majors are in demand By 2016 there will be more than 1.5 million new high- end computing jobs Five of.
Chapter Eight Academic Survival Skills. Study Skills  For most students time is the greatest issue.  The first rule to follow is to allow two or three.
Project CC4U2 Setting an Efficient Partnership for Allowing International Student Exchanges: a Difficult Issue Philippe Lahire University of Nice Sophia.
UNIVERSITY OF SOUTH CAROLINA Department of Computer Science and Engineering CSCE 190 Careers in Computer Science, Computer Engineering, and Computer Information.
Information Technology Lonnie Bentley, Professor and Head Department of Computer Technology (CPT) - and - H. E. (Buster) Dunsmore, Professor Department.
Web Service Development Within Different Study Years Maja Pušnik, Boštjan Šumak Institute of Informatics, FERI Maribor.
On Behalf of the BSEE Curriculum Committee Profs. R. Gary Daniels, Gustavo de Veciana, Brian L. Evans, Gary Hallock, Jack Lee, and Rebecca Richards-Kortum.
1 COMPSCI 110 Operating Systems Who - Introductions How - Policies and Administrative Details Why - Objectives and Expectations What - Our Topic: Operating.
OBJECT ORIENTED SYSTEM ANALYSIS AND DESIGN. COURSE OUTLINE The world of the Information Systems Analyst Approaches to System Development The Analyst as.
1 Chapter Nine Engineering Your Career. 2 Engineering Careers  Electrical and computer engineers find employment in: 1.Private industry. 2.Government.
VESL-Career & life planning Career Presentation April 13, 2011 Mt.SAC.
Presenters: Adam Andy Andy
Computer Engineering at the University of Houston.
KJC001 (sp2015.ppt – May 12, 2015) – Industry senior project presentation Industry-based Senior Project in the Department of Computer Science and Engineering.
ECE 396 – Senior Design I Fall 2015 Semester Lecture 1 Introduction to Senior Design.
1. Where to use Multimedia ? 2  Business  Government  Education  Broadcasting & Entertainment  Research & Development  Health.
CSE 102 Introduction to Computer Engineering What is Computer Engineering?
Jensen Berlitz 5th period
CSPC 464 Fall 2014 Son Nguyen.  Attendance/Roster  Introduction ◦ Instructor ◦ Students  Syllabus  Q & A.
CS Curriculum Changes Fall, BS Computer Science 2015 COMPUTER SCIENCE COURSES—64 Hours COMPUTER SCIENCE CORE (48 Hours) CS 258Intro to Object-Oriented.
1 IT Skill Standard and HEDSPI Curriculum Chief Advisor Gouba.
Computer Engineering Department (KFUPM) Computer Engineering Department Sadiq M. Sait College of Computer Sciences and Engineering.
My audience will be excited to learn the basics of what a network systems & data communications analyst does.
CHAPTER 3 Systems Considerations in the Design of an HRIS.
Industry Advisory Board
Why Should You Apply to Graduate School? Masters Degree
Optimizing STEM Programs to Promote Enrollment and Retention
7th Grade Career Exploration Module
Accepted Students Program
Industry-based Senior Project in the
Computer Science Education Week
What are your Career Options?
CS1301 – Where it Fits Institute for Personal Robots in Education
University of Nice Sophia Antipolis
CS1301 – Where it Fits Institute for Personal Robots in Education
Presentation transcript:

Why You Should All Become Computer Engineers ECE 200 (Fall 2015) Saurabh Bagchi School of Electrical and Computer Engineering Purdue University

Purdue ECE: Technical Areas Purdue ECE is divided into nine technical areas ‣ Computer Engineering ‣ VLSI and Circuit Design ‣ Communications, Networking, Signal & Image Processing ‣ Microelectronics and Nanotechnology ‣ Biomedical Imaging and Sensing ‣ Power and Energy Devices and Systems ‣ Fields and Optics ‣ Automatic Control ‣ Education Each ECE faculty has a primary affiliation with one of these areas

Where do you find Computers? Everywhere!

Designing the iPhone 5 What does it involve? Hardware, Software, Algorithms, Signal Processing, Wireless Communication, Industrial Design

Entertainment for our Future You may tell your grandkids one day what a TV was Future of music, movies, and all entertainment is on the Internet and are moving there fast You can help revolutionize the entertainment industry as a Computer Engineer Acknowledgment: ACM Computing Careers web site

ECE Advanced C Programming ECE Object-Oriented Prog. in C++ and Java ECE Software Engineering Tools Laboratory ECE Data Structures (and Algorithms) ECE 404 – Computer Security ECE Introduction to Computer Networks ECE Introduction to Compilers ECE Operating Systems Engineering ECE Software for Embedded Systems Courses (Software)

Key Things to Keep in Mind To be a standout computer engineer, you must often know both hardware and software (you will likely specialize in one, but should have a good understanding of how the other works) You will learn much more by actually doing than by hearing, watching, or reading Dare to be different: An innovative project perhaps Keep the big picture in mind: The reason you are here is to learn and get prepared for the real world, not just to get a grade

Possible Career Paths For someone with a Software focus 1.Designing and implementing software ‣ Software development including web development, security issues, mobile development, and interface design ‣ Bachelor’s degree usually sufficient for entry but professionals often come back for a Master’s 2.Devising new ways to use computers ‣ Refers to innovation in the application of computer technology ‣ Sometimes involves advanced graduate work, followed by position in a research university or industrial research and development laboratory ‣ Can involve entrepreneurial activity 3.Planning and managing organizational IT infrastructure ‣ Manage people to get projects done ‣ Make cost-benefit decisions about what kind of IT infrastructure to adopt for efficiency, scalability, usability, future evolution ‣ Professionals often come back to get an advanced degree

What Skills You Should Look To Pick Up 1.Technical computing skills ‣ Problem-solving ability, recognizing levels of abstraction in software, hardware systems, and multimedia ‣ Practical skills such as building and using database management systems and other sophisticated software tools ‣ Programming, including using existing software libraries to carry out a variety of computing tasks, such as creating a user interface ‣ Being aware of the uses to which computers are put, recognizing issues to do with security, safety, etc. ‣ Looking at innovative ways of using computers, creating tools, providing support 2.General professional skills 3.(Optionally) Specialized domain knowledge

What Skills You Should Look To Pick Up 1.Technical computing skills 2.General professional skills ‣ Communicating in writing, giving effective presentations and product demonstrations, and being a good negotiator ‣ Preparing for a job search; this involves building an impressive curriculum vitae and basing this confidently on your skills ‣ Being an effective team member ‣ Understanding the special requirements of a globally distributed project with participants from multiple cultures ‣ Recognizing the challenges and opportunities of keeping skills up-to-date and understand how to do so 3.(Optionally) Specialized domain knowledge ‣ Example: Medicine, if you want to go into applications of computer technology to healthcare ‣ Example: Business, if you want to start up a company

A Note About Course Scheduling Most of you looking for jobs will interview in the Fall semester of your senior year (assuming you plan to graduate in Spring) Make sure you complete as many ECE courses as you can by then For example, software focused BSCmpE students should (ideally) have completed (or currently doing) 437, 468, and 469. Hardware focused students should (ideally) have completed (or currently doing) 337, 437, and 456 You have a choice of electives (Complementary Elective, CmpE elective) - Choose wisely!

Questions?